Brick Hardscaping in West Hartford, CT
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and repair of durable outdoor features constructed with brick materials. These projects often include pat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or steps. Homeowners typically seek these services to enhance the aesthetic appeal of their property, improve functionality, or address issues such as uneven surfaces or structural stability.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ider factors like the desired style, the load-bearing capacity of the area, and any specific maintenance or durability requirements to ensure the project aligns with their outdoor environment.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ects is essential for property owners planning to upgrade their outdoor spaces. Common questions involve the selection of brick types, the overall design compatibility with existing landscaping, and the longevity of the materials used. It’s also helpful to clarify any site-specific conditions, such as drainage or soil stability, that could influence the project's success. Having a clear idea of these considerations can facilitate a smoother planning process and ensure the finished hardscape meets expectations for both appearance and performance.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ance outdoor spaces.
How durable are brick hardscaping features? Brick structures are known for their strength and longevity, making them a practical choice for outdoor use.
What maintenance is needed for brick hardscaping? Regular cleaning and occasional joint repointing help maintain the appearance and stability of brick features.
Can brick hardscaping be customized to match existing property styles? Yes, bricks come in various colors and patterns to complement different landscape designs and architectural styles.
